|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Roof Inspection | $200 - $500 |
| Minor Repairs | $300 - $1,200 |
| Shingle Replacement |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Full Roof Replacement |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Roof Vent Installation | $250 - $750 |
| Flashing Repair | $400 - $1,200 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Roof services in Southwick, MA, encompass a variety of projects ranging from repairs to full replacements. Understanding typical project scopes and the factors that influence costs can help property owners make informed decisions. This overview highlights key considerations involved in common roofing projects in the area.
-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, each with different durability and aesthetic qualities.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s on individual sections to complete roof replacements for entire structures.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and existing conditions can influence the difficulty and duration of work.
- Permitting: Many projects require permits from local authorities, especially for full replacements or structural modifications.
- Additional Services: Extras may include roof insulation, ventilation upgrades, or installation of new flashing and gutters.
